大连码上未来IT培训

走出全栈开发的认知迷雾

发布日期:2025年05月24日

走出全栈开发的认知迷雾

在某创业公司的技术复盘会议上,CTO 指出过度追求全栈导致的技术债务问题:因前端工程师缺乏数据库优化经验,系统上线 3 个月后出现索引失效,导致交易卡顿。这个案例暴露出全栈开发中常见的认知误区 —— 技术广度与深度的平衡问题,警示从业者需要理性看待全栈开发的价值边界。

一个认知陷阱是 "全栈等于全能"。某金融科技公司曾尝试让全栈团队承担所有开发任务,结果在高并发场景下,因缺乏专业后端工程师的架构设计,系统吞吐量仅达预期的 60%。行业调研显示,62% 的全栈项目存在过度设计问题,根源在于忽视了技术分工的专业性。正确的做法是建立 "T 型能力结构",在掌握全栈技术的基础上,深耕 1-2 个技术领域,如分布式系统或前端工程化。

?二个误区是 "工具论"。随着 AI 代码生成工具的普及,某电商团队尝试用 Copilot 生成 80% 的代码,结果在安全审计中发现,自动生成的代码存在 15% 的潜在漏洞,修复成本反而增加。腾讯云的实践表明,AI 工具应定位为效率辅助,关键代码仍需人工审查,同时建立自动化安全扫描机制,将漏洞发现率提升 3 倍。技术工具的价值在于提升效能,而非替代开发者的核心能力。

忽视架构设计的重要性是第三个常见问题。某政务平台项目为追求快速交付,采用单体架构进行全栈开发,上线一年后因扩展性不足被迫重构,耗时比原计划增加 200%。杭州银行的经验显示,在全栈开发初期就引入领域驱动设计(DDD),将核心业务拆分为 50 + 微服务,使系统可维护性提升 10 倍,故障隔离能力显著增强。架构思维是全栈开发的底层支撑,而非后期优化选项。

破局之道在于建立科学的能力评估体系。阿里巴巴推行的技术雷达机制值得借鉴,通过定期评估技术成熟度、团队适配度和业务价值,动态调整技术栈组合。同时,企业应构建 "全栈 + 专家" 的混合团队,让全栈工程师负责需求贯通和流程整合,专业工程师深耕关键技术领域,形成优势互补。

当我们走出 "全栈神话" 的迷雾,会发现其真正价值在于打通技术链路、提升协作效率,而非要求开发者掌握所有技术。理性看待全栈开发的能力边界,建立 "广度为基、深度为要" 的技术体系,才能让这项技术真正赋能产业,避免陷入为全栈而全栈的盲目实践。

加微信咨询
夏老师 @码上未来IT培训
微信号:155******12

资深职业咨询规划师

微信咨询
相关资讯
未来展望篇:从工具到自主智能体 社会影响篇:AI 重塑就业与生活范式 技术突破篇:多模态与深度推理的跨越 商业模式篇:从通用模型到行业定制 算力基建篇:智能算力的军备竞赛
相关课程